I just bought a Vibrant resonator to install and see how it changes the noise.
Due to the 106.67hz frequency of the drone, that's a 12.5 foot sine wave I think - so the resonator would have to be 12.5 feet long to actually help with the drone. What the vibrant resonator is going to do is filter out high frequencies, which tends to exacerbate the drone on the mbrp. There's a post here on the forum about all the work I put into identifying and mitigating mbrp drone, the end product cost a little more than an thermal exhaust system and wasn't even stainless steel.
